Can Race And Ethnicity Be Used Interchangeably? Race and ethnicity are often regarded as the same, but the social and biological sciences consider the concepts distinct. In general, people can adopt or deny ethnic affiliations more readily than racial ones, though different ethnicities have been folded into racial categories during different periods of history. Are

How Does Ethnocentrism Affect Society? It reinforces wrong assumptions and premature judgements on people of different cultures and therefore gives a vague feeling of superiority. … At the society levels, ethnocentrism deters the interaction among people of different cultures, ethnic groups, gender and age. Is The Belief That Your Own Culture Is Superior To All Others? Ethnocentrism is a belief in the superiority of your own culture. It results from judging other cultures by your own cultural ideals. What Does Ethnicity Mean To Anthropologists Quizlet? What does ethnicity mean to anthropologists quizlet? What Does “Ethnicity” Mean to Anthropologists? Ethnicity is a sense of historical, cultural, and sometimes ancestral connection to a group of people who are believed to be distinct from those outside the group.
